About Clipstone Brook Lower School
Located in the heart of Leighton Buzzard, our school serves around 300 pupils from ages 3 to 9, including a 16-place pre-school setting. We proudly cater to an increasingly diverse community.
Our school ethos is built on kindness, respect, and restorative approaches that create a safe and nurturing environment where pupils grow both academically and personally.
Our vision — Belong, Thrive, Learn — guides our work every day and is at the heart of our school community.
About the Role
As a Class Teacher at Clipstone Brook Lower School, you will:
- Deliver high-quality, engaging lessons that motivate pupils and foster a love of learning
- Plan thoughtfully to meet the needs of all pupils, including those with SEND, ensuring every child makes good progress
- Act as a subject specialist and contribute to curriculum development, assessment, and teaching strategies
- Support and mentor colleagues and trainees, sharing your expertise and enthusiasm
- Play a full part in school life, working collaboratively with staff, pupils, and parents to uphold our values and ethos
- Commit to your own continuous professional development, staying up-to-date with educational best practice and contributing to whole-school improvement
This role offers the opportunity to make a meaningful impact in a supportive and reflective environment where your contribution will be valued.
